Lord, Aeck & Sargent Designs Research Facility; LEED™ Rating System Served as Guideline for Sustainable Design Strategies

January 10, 2006

The National Park Service has started construction on the Twin Creeks Science and Education Center, a first-of-its-kind National Park Service research facility that will support the All Taxa Biodiversity Inventory (ATBI). The ATBI is an initiative to document all life forms in this half a million-acre national park and help scientists make critical decisions about protecting and preserving the park’s ecosystem.
